Miter Saw Mastery: Cutting Aluminium with Precision
Achieving perfect cuts more info of aluminium with your compound saw demands particular techniques. Compared to wood, aluminium tends to stick to the blade , potentially causing a jagged edge and reverse action . To circumvent this, routinely use a fine-tooth blade designed for aluminum . Reducing the cutting speed – that's how fast you push the material into the blade – is critical ; a gradual approach yields much more accurate results. Moreover , lubricating the blade with a lubricant can lessen gumming and improve the overall cut appearance .
Picking the Best Miter Device for Metal Projects
When working with metal projects, choosing the ideal miter tool is critical . Standard miter devices can struggle and harm the malleable material, leading to uneven cuts and scrap pieces. Look for a device with a micro-tooth blade specifically designed for non-ferrous metals, or consider a cold-cutting miter saw which eliminates heat buildup and minimizes the probability of warping . The function to modify blade RPM is also helpful for achieving clean, precise cuts.
